## v2.8.0 — Setting renamed

In Spokeshift, the bike-share rebalancing tool, the setting `DISPATCH_KEY` has been renamed to `SPOKESHIFT_DISPATCH_TOKEN` to clarify scope and avoid collisions with the fleet importer. The old name is read for one more release, then removed; both are treated as secrets and excluded from logs. Reviewers should confirm rotation happened at rename time. Operators must add the new entry to the service env file as follows.

vault entry, yahif-yajep: COURIER_KEY29=b802bdf8034096b65a51c6ba5abe2

Troubleshooting the Copperline tile cache in CI: if map snapshots render blank, the cache warmer likely timed out before seeding zoom levels 0–6. Check the warm-cache stage duration; anything under 40 seconds means it was skipped. Retry the stage once before escalating. When escalating, include the build token printed at the top of the failed log, shown below.

session token of tajef-bageg = htk21_5d90d574934f3ccae6437

## Formula sandbox tuning

User-supplied formulas in Gridmoor execute inside a restricted interpreter with hard ceilings on time, memory, and call depth. Reviewers should confirm any change to these ceilings is justified in the PR description, since raising them widens the abuse surface. Defaults were chosen from production traces. The current limits are as follows.

limits module of tafog-fawip:
WEIGHTS = {
    "julix": 57,
    "lamys": 992,
    "kasvan": 209,
    "quenok": 750,
    "alddor": 259,
    "oliath": 1009,
    "wenix": 815,
}

**Ticket: Graphweft renders phantom edges after node collapse**

Severity: Medium. Observed in Graphweft 2.4 on the Ferncastle build.

Steps to reproduce:
1. Load a project with at least 40 dependencies.
2. Collapse any mid-tier node, then expand it twice quickly.
3. Phantom edges appear linking unrelated packages.

Expected: edge set matches the manifest. Actual: 3–5 spurious edges persist until reload. To fetch the failing graph payload from the staging API, authenticate with the token below.

portal login ticket: eyJhbGciOiJIUzI1NiIsInR5cCI6IkpXVCJ9.eyJzdWIiOiI0Z4ywpUMsBIn0.ca5FVhkdBXa3